
What is recorded here
In pasture, on break in S-facing slope. Oval area (27.5m N-S; 17.1m E-W) enclosed by earthen bank (int. H 0.75m; ext. H 1.3m) W->NE, and defined by scarped edge (H 1.4m; Wth 1.7m) NE->W, with an external fosse (Wth 1.5m) WNW->ENE and SSE->SSW, and a counterscarp bank (int. H 0.7m; ext. H 0.2m) along outer edge of fosse at NE. Presence of fosse ENE->SSE could not be determined due to overgrowth and dumping of organic debris. Scarp highest ENE->SSE but also where covered by dense overgrowth. Field boundaries abut scarp at ENE and SSE. Interior level and under pasture. Bushes and whitethorn trees grow along bank.
